The Women of Troy lost to the Oregon Ducks 72-48. USC did not have any answers for the surging Ducks, who sit 13-6 on the season. Oregon was looking to end their three-game losing streak.

The UCLA Bruins started slowly against USC in a highly anticipated matchup. They defeated the Women of Troy 73-66 in a very emotional game.
The Women of Troy defeated Colorado Buffaloes 69-54 in a sensational win led by Pac-12 Freshman of the Year Alissa Pili. She finished with 22 pts, 5 rebs, and two assists.
After a tenacious effort in the second half, the USC women’s basketball team lost to the Arizona State Sun Devils 63-54. The Women of Troy dissolved a 20-point deficit to a nine-point difference, keeping their competitive spirit high in the final minutes of the game.
The USC women’s basketball team defeated the UNLV Lady Rebels 75-54. A solid commitment to offense and defense in the first half gave the Women of Troy an advantage.

The UCLA Bruins gained the title “Best in LA” with the team’s second win in four days against their crosstown rivals, the USC Trojans at the Galen Center on Feb. 5
The Trojans came into the game averaging 70 points per game, but the Bruins energetic zone defense forced USC into contested jumpers, resulting in 23 missed shots through 20 minutes of play.
